New Developments in the Art & Science of Vision Training

 The Way of Sports and Exercise Your Eyes Inc. are offering a free 1-hour seminar, to introduce you to an exciting new development in the art & science of vision training. This live conference call is by invitation only to baseball players, coaches, and trainers.

Objectives

During this seminar, you will be introduced to the EYEPORT Vision Training System and learn how to incorporate this effective tool into your training regimen. The EYEPORT is the only patented, clinically proven and FDA-cleared device that significantly improves overall visual performance in less than 10-minutes a day. Published studies clearly demonstrate that using the EYEPORT significantly improves:

Visual Attention
Reading Efficiency & Comprehension
Athletic Performance and Marksmanship
Aiming, Tracking, Focusing & Teaming of the Eyes
Speed & Span of Perception & Dynamic Depth Perception

Presenters

Dr. Jacob Liberman received a Doctorate of Optometry in 1973, a Ph.D. in Vision Science in 1986 and an Honorary Doctorate of Science in 1996. He is the author of Light: Medicine of the Future, Take Off Your Glasses and See and Wisdom From an Empty Mind.

Pat Ahearne is a pitching instructor and International Director at the Rod Dedeaux Research & Baseball Institute at USC in Los Angeles. He was a member of the 1992 Pepperdine National Championship team, and played 16 seasons of professional baseball, including major league time with the Detroit Tigers.
